Release step 7 — CroplineOS Gateway 3.2. Confirm the build originated from the locked release branch and that both reviewers on the Thornbury security rota approved the diff. Verify the SBOM matches the artifact digest recorded in the audit ledger. No unsigned telemetry modules may ship to field units. The signing key authorized for this release window, rotated per policy on Monday, is as follows.

release key, kawig-hahap: bky19_jKFMyjZ83WdMDLxNyxG

Runbook: Tilecrest cache layer — stale tile purge

If map tiles look frozen in time, the Tilecrest cache probably stopped evicting. Check the eviction worker first; it tends to wedge after a deploy. Restarting it is safe and usually enough. If tiles are still stale after ten minutes, trigger a manual purge against the internal Glazeworks render service — scoped to the affected zoom levels only, please, a full purge melts the renderers. The Glazeworks key for the purge call is below.

app token of kawif-yafop = zpat2_88

Attendees reviewed the proposed sale of the Pellgrove Fabrication unit to Northgale Holdings. Due diligence is in its second phase; customer contracts are being mapped for transfer consent. Sales leads were reminded that existing Pellgrove pipeline activity continues unchanged and that no external discussion of the transaction is permitted until announcement. Hana will coordinate the client communication pack; timing depends on the signing date. For context on what happens after close, see the note below.

board note of bawep-tajef: Queniusek Systems plans to raise the Quenvan list price by 53.1 percent in March. The pricing group signed off on a budget of $176.4 million for Project Drueth. The renewal with Casionix Partners closes at $142.5 million a year, 8.3 percent below the last contract. Project Fraax slips by six weeks because of the tooling delay.